Forest Road 183 (Stone Coal Road, Broad Run Road) will be closed from the end of State Road 748 to the intersection with Forest Road 224 (Wildlife"]]></description><pubDate>Sat, 21 Jun 2008 09:00:00 -06:00</pubDate></item><item><title><![CDATA["Stone Coal Fire Update 4:30 PM  (Stone Coal Wildland Fire)"]]></title><link>http://inciweb.org/incident/news/article/1335/6908/</link><guid isPermaLink="true">http://inciweb.org/incident/news/article/1335/6908/</guid><description><![CDATA["The Stone Coal Fire on Caldwell Mountain in Botetourt County has grown to 100 acres and is being managed as a wildland fire for resource benefit.This method allows fire personnel to manage the fire in a similar manner to prescribed fire where control lines are placed around a specific area and the fire is used to benefit the area by clearing dense brush and creating a more open environment for wildlife. Safety of firefighters is also increased since exposure to an environment with steep, rough terrain, limited access and old coal mines is limited since control lines are established in more accessible areas.Resources ordered to work on the fire include bulldozers that are opening roads on top of the mountain, the Augusta Hotshot Crew and a"]]></description><pubDate>Thu, 19 Jun 2008 16:59:00 -06:00</pubDate></item></channel></rss>
